BIOL 3210
Biology of Microorganisms ((4 Credits))
Empire State University · UGRD · Fall 2026
Catalog description
This is an advanced level course exploring of microorganisms. Topics to be explored include biochemistry and cell biology of microorganisms; growth and growth prevention of bacteria; classification of microorganisms; viral genetics and replication cycles; interactions between microbes and host (including immunology); and a survey of human diseases caused by microorganisms. Students will learn the concepts with a historical perspective. Students will also learn about important infectious diseases that affect humans and their causative agents. Prerequisite (must complete before registering): Biology I with Lab ( BIOL 1200 ) or Introduction to Cell Biology and Genetics ( BIOL 1204 ) Note: This course meets the guidelines for Biology concentrations. This course is intended for science students.
